Transaction 9bb011d632bc7651ecfd9a96cc869431949f20430deee8408caebe8431aa4a94
1 Input
1 Output
-
9bb011d632bc7651ecfd9a96cc869431949f20430deee8408caebe8431aa4a94:0
- value
- 1867930225
- script pubkey
- OP_PUSHBYTES_33 020ef2912cbab60a810d6f8f23f4bade35be655e681a3e7ce12102eca30c94d1ba OP_CHECKSIG